The Traitor: A Story of the Fall of the Invisible Empire by Jr. Thomas Dixon
"The Traitor: A Story of the Fall of the Invisible Empire" by Thomas Dixon Jr. is a novel published in 1907. The third installment in Dixon's Ku Klux Klan trilogy, it follows Confederate veteran John Graham as Grand Dragon of the Klan in North Carolina. When the original Klan disbands under orders from its first Grand Wizard, a rival starts a new organization. The novel explores Dixon's distinction between what he viewed
as the "good" original Klan and a more violent successor group during the Reconstruction era. (This is an automatically generated summary.)
